869 PSI to Bar

869 PSI equals 59.915 bar.

Formula: PSI × 0.0689476 = bar

How do I convert 869 PSI to bar without a calculator?
Divide by 14.5 for a quick estimate: 869 ÷ 14.5 ≈ 59.93 bar. The exact answer is 59.915 bar.
